And I should mention that I now have the ID Lab critter braving the shock zone arena. It gave me a chance to improve the place cell behavior, before releasing any software.

Most of the problems I had around a year ago are now gone. The ones that remain (mainly freezing up when stuck in the middle of the shock zone) seem to be caused by too many cells signaling at one time, which is a problem I expected. To see what happens when kept as simple as possible I had to start off by combining room and arena frames into a single network representation for both, even though I already knew this results in a somewhat overwhelming amount of information all in one place. It's still very useful behavior to have and a good first step towards mastering the most challenging test of them all, for testing two frame place avoidance skills.
